Hyatt acquires me and all hotels to boost expansion in Europe

Hyatt Hotels has added me and all hotels into its brand portfolio. In a statement, Hyatt announced that an affiliate had acquired me and all hotels from family-owned German hotel company, Lindner Hotels AG. The purchase price was not disclosed.

The acquisition will help Hyatt expand its presence into newer markets across Europe and build on its strong momentum in the region. The deal closed on Friday.

me and all hotels, which is currently a nested brand within Hyatt’s JdV by Hyatt brand, will now become a standalone brand within Hyatt’s global lifestyle portfolio, which has quintupled in rooms between 2017 and the end of 2023.

The acquisition builds on the partnership that Hyatt and Lindner entered into in 2022, which helped Hyatt grow its footprint in Germany and Europe. All Lindner Hotels & Resorts properties and me and all hotels have been integrated into the World of Hyatt loyalty program.

“The Lindner team has built an incredible brand with me and all hotels, and we believe the brand has great potential for expansion across Europe and other global markets,” said Felicity Black-Roberts, SVP Development EAME, Hyatt. “Our collaboration with Lindner was a significant step forward for our distribution in the EAME region, expanding our brand footprint and offering many new locations to our 46 million World of Hyatt members.”

Launched in 2016 as Lindner’s urban lifestyle sister brand, the me and all hotels portfolio has grown to six hotels with more than 1,000 rooms in Germany. These properties are currently part of Hyatt’s inventory. The brand also has hotels in its pipeline, including conversions and new builds in destinations such as Berlin (to open later this year), Hamburg, Leipzig and Stuttgart (all slated to open in 2026). Additionally, there are more me and all developments in various stages of negotiation in destinations beyond Germany.

The me and all hotels brand offers conversion-friendly development model in the desirable upscale lifestyle space, positioning it for scale and accelerated expansion across Europe and beyond, Hyatt said in the statement.

“We are thrilled to deepen our successful collaboration and shift into high-growth gear for me and all hotels, backed by Hyatt’s global distribution engine,” said Arno Schwalie, CEO, Lindner. “The combination of the successful work we have done to launch and position the brand in Germany, its vibrant pipeline, and the potential for growth as part of Hyatt makes us confident that what has become a beloved lifestyle brand in Germany will soon shine on the global stage.”

The acquisition of me and all hotels is Hyatt’s first deal this year. The hospitality group has been expanding its portfolio with the recent acquisitions of Dream Hospitality Group, Mr & Mrs Smith, Apple Leisure Group and Two Roads Hospitality.
